Top 10 Engineering Jobs for Fresher’s in 2025

The job landscape for engineers is rapidly evolving in 2025. With the rise of digital technologies, automation, and green innovations, the demand for skilled engineers is at an all-time high. Freshers in engineering have more opportunities than ever before but choosing the right role can make all the difference. 

According to a recent NASSCOM report, India is expected to see over 1.5 million tech job openings by 2025, with a significant portion targeted at fresh graduates. With the right skills and direction, freshers can enter high-growth industries from the very beginning of their careers.

Top 10 Engineering Jobs for Freshers in India 


Engineering is a vast field. Some domains are growing faster due to technological advancements. The following 10 jobs are considered some of the best choices for freshers in 2025. 

Each of these roles offers great career potential, attractive salaries, and strong demand across industries. 


1. Software Engineer / Developer 

Software development continues to be the top choice for engineering freshers. It offers flexibility, high salaries, and global opportunities. 

Industry Demand: 

Software engineers are needed in IT services, startups, fintech, edtech, and almost every digital business. With India’s digital economy projected to reach $1 trillion by 2026, this role will remain in demand. 

Skills Required: 

  • Python / Java / C++ 
  • Data Structures & Algorithms 
  • Git / GitHub 
  • Web frameworks (React, Angular) 
  • SQL and databases 
  • Problem-solving 

Average Salary Package: 

₹4–8 LPA for freshers in India. Higher packages in product companies and startups. 


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

You get to work on real projects from day one. You learn in-demand skills and can explore backend, frontend, or full-stack development. 


2. Data Analyst / Data Engineer 

Data roles are growing fast. Organizations rely on data to make decisions and forecast trends. 

Industry Demand: 

Used in e-commerce, banking, healthcare, and IT. According to LinkedIn, Data Analyst roles are among the top 5 emerging jobs in India. 

Skills Required: 

  • SQL 
  • Excel and Google Sheets 
  • Python or R 
  • Power BI / Tableau 
  • Data cleaning and visualization 
  • Statistical analysis 

Average Salary Package: 

₹4.5–9 LPA depending on industry and location.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

These roles are easy to enter with strong logic and analytical skills. There is strong growth potential into data science or ML engineering. 

3. Mechanical Design Engineer
Mechanical engineers with design skills are essential for product innovation. 


Industry Demand: 
Automotive, manufacturing, aerospace, and heavy industries rely heavily on mechanical designers. 

Skills Required: 
  • AutoCAD 
  • SolidWorks 
  • CATIA 
  • GD&T 
  • Engineering Drawing 
  • Simulation Tools 
Average Salary Package: 
₹3–6 LPA depending on project and company.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 
You get exposure to real-world mechanical systems and innovation. Ideal for those who love designing machines and products. 

4. Civil Site Engineer 

India’s infrastructure boom continues. Civil engineers are in high demand for both government and private projects. 

Industry Demand: 

Real estate, construction firms, smart cities, and transportation projects need site engineers. 

Skills Required: 

  • AutoCAD 
  • Project management
  • basics Site supervision
  •  Surveying techniques 
  • Construction Materials 

Average Salary Package: 
₹2.5–5.5 LPA depending on region and size of project. 



Why it’s Great for Freshers: 
Ideal for hands-on learning on-site. Freshers gain experience in real-time construction environments. 

5. Electrical/Electronic Engineer

From electric vehicles to power grids, electronics engineers are vital. 


Industry Demand: 
Power, telecom, electronics, robotics, and energy sectors all need these engineers. 


Skills Required:
  • Circuit Design 
  • MATLAB 
  • PLC & SCADA 
  • Embedded Systems 
  • IoT Concepts 

Average Salary Package: 

₹3–6.5 LPA depending on skills and domain.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

Practical roles with strong fundamentals. Opportunities in both public and private sectors. 

 6. AI/ML Engineer 

Artificial Intelligence is transforming every industry. It’s one of the most lucrative engineering domains in 2025. 

Industry Demand: 

High demand in fintech, healthcare, robotics, cybersecurity, and autonomous vehicles. 

Skills Required: 

  • Python 
  • TensorFlow / PyTorch 
  • Machine Learning Algorithms 
  • Linear Algebra 
  • Data Processing 
  • NLP 

Average Salary Package: 

₹6–12 LPA for freshers, depending on skill level.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

Strong future scope. Many startups and global companies hire AI talent from India. 

7. Cloud Engineer / DevOps Engineer

Companies are moving to the cloud. DevOps ensures smooth deployment and automation. 

Industry Demand: 

SaaS firms, IT services, fintech, edtech, and MNCs need cloud experts. 

Skills Required: 

  • AWS / Azure / Google Cloud 
  • Docker / Kubernetes 
  • CI/CD Pipelines 
  • Linux 
  • Scripting (Bash / Python) 

Average Salary Package: 

₹5–10 LPA based on certifications and project work.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

High-paying roles with remote work options. Great for those who enjoy automation and systems architecture. 

8. Cybersecurity Analyst


With cyber-attacks on the rise, cybersecurity is a booming field. 

Industry Demand: 

Banks, IT firms, telecom, and e-commerce companies require security professionals. 

Skills Required: 

  • Ethical Hacking 
  • Network Security 
  • Firewalls 
  • SIEM Tools
  • Cyber Laws & Compliance 

Average Salary Package: 

₹4.5–9 LPA for entry-level roles. 


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

It's a high-growth area. Specialized roles with strong job security. 


 9. QA/Test Engineer 

Quality Assurance ensures that products work smoothly before launch. 

Industry Demand: 

IT companies, SaaS products, gaming, and mobile app development. 

Skills Required: 

  • Manual Testing 
  • Selenium / Automation Tools 
  • Agile and Scrum 
  • Test Case Design 
  • JIRA / Bug Tracking Tools 

Average Salary Package: 

₹3–6 LPA for freshers.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

Easy to enter. Builds strong understanding of software lifecycle and processes. 

10. Electronics & Communication Engineer (ECE Roles)

ECE freshers can explore diverse technical roles from VLSI to IoT. 

Industry Demand: 

Telecom, semiconductor, consumer electronics, and embedded systems. 

Skills Required:  

  • VLSI Design 
  • PCB Design 
  • Signal Processing 
  • IoT Protocols 
  • Arduino / Raspberry Pi 

Average Salary Package: 

₹3.5–7 LPA depending on skills and specialization. 

Why it’s Great for Freshers: 

Wide range of industries. Great for innovation and future tech exposure.

FAQs About Engineering Jobs for Freshers in India 

These are some commonly asked questions by freshers looking to begin their careers in engineering: 


Q1. Are software jobs suitable for non-CS/IT engineers? 

Yes, many software companies hire non-CS/IT graduates who have strong programming skills. You can build these skills through certifications, coding bootcamps, and self-learning platforms. 


Q2. What is the average starting salary for engineering freshers in India? 

The average salary ranges from ₹3 LPA to ₹6 LPA. However, in domains like AI, Cloud, and Product Development, freshers can earn up to ₹12 LPA or more. 


Q3. How does AI/ML impact job prospects for engineers? 

AI and ML are transforming traditional engineering roles. Engineers with knowledge of machine learning can work in automation, robotics, analytics, and more. It’s a great area for freshers to build careers. 


Q4. What are the top engineering sectors hiring in 2025? 

Top sectors include IT & software, Data Science, AI/ML, Cloud Computing, Renewable Energy, Electric Vehicles, Construction, and Cybersecurity. 


Q5. Can freshers get remote engineering jobs in India? 

Yes, many companies offer remote roles, especially in software, DevOps, data analytics, and content engineering. Remote jobs are increasing post-pandemic.
